I just remembered another thread about selling eggs and how people were saying that those selling for under 2.00 should up their prices...for one, it costs twice that for brown "farm" eggs at the store here and those aren't free ranged or organic. They don't taste nearly as good either imho.
Also, there is perceived value to consider. As silly as it is, a surprising number of people can't get past $ as a measure of value/worth. If your eggs are healthier and tastier than the store eggs at half the price, for those people the store eggs would be superior in their mind.
Don't forget the extra labor and expense you have vs the big egg factories with 100,000 chickens stuffed in cages too small to turn around in and conveyor belts feeding the hens and collecting eggs. Those guys are producing $1+ eggs. It seems silly to me to think our eggs are not worth more. A simple taste test proved to me long ago that our eggs blow those away for taste.
